Backyard landscape lighting ideas
The best backyard lighting ideas combine moonlighting from large trees for soft overall light, uplights on specimen plants and features, warm path and step lights for safe movement, and accent lighting around patios, pools, and seating. Layering these turns a backyard into a usable, resort-like space after dark.
High-impact ideas
- Moonlight the patio from a nearby shade tree for soft, natural coverage
- Uplight a signature tree, water feature, or garden sculpture as a focal point
- Wash a privacy fence or hedge to make the yard feel larger
- Add warm bistro or hardscape lighting around seating and the grill
- Light pool edges and steps for safety and ambiance
Make it usable, not just pretty
The goal of backyard lighting is to extend the hours you actually use the space. Balance beauty with practical light where you cook, sit, and walk, and you'll be outside far more often.
